手机技巧

shouji
首页 > 手机技巧 > 正文内容

苹果id登录安卓(苹果id官网)

admin3年前 (2023-05-27)手机技巧175

苹果id登录安卓的实现方法

1、苹果id登录安卓的需求

苹果id登录安卓(苹果id官网)

苹果id是苹果公司为库存管理、用户统一认证和支付等目的设计的。苹果id在iOS系统下,是不可或缺的,但在Android系统下,很多用户也想使用苹果id,那么苹果id登录安卓该如何实现呢?

首先,我们需要知道的是,苹果id的登录认证机制是基于OAuth2.0的。OAuth2.0是一个用于认证的标准协议,许多公司和组织都会使用OAuth2.0来实现登录认证功能。

2、实现方法

那么,要在安卓系统中实现苹果id登录,需要经过以下步骤:

1. 获取苹果id登录凭证(code等);

2. 通过苹果id登录凭证向苹果服务器请求Access Token;

3. 使用Access Token向苹果服务器请求用户信息。

有了这个Flow,只要我们能够在安卓应用中向苹果服务器发起请求,就能够实现苹果id登录了。

3、实现步骤详解

第一步:获取苹果id登录凭证

在安卓系统中,我们可以通过WebView来让用户登录苹果id。WebView可以处理页面登录事件,当用户输入用户名和密码后,我们可以通过WebViewClient拦截页面加载事件,将请求重定向到一个链接,比如:https://your-app.com/apple/auth,这个链接我们需要在自己的服务器端实现。

第二步:请求Access Token

在自己的服务器端实现拦截苹果id登录请求的处理,并请求Access Token。我们可以在服务器端使用Java或其他语言来向苹果服务器请求Access Token。有了Access Token之后,你就可以使用这个Access Token来向苹果服务器请求用户信息了。

第三步:请求用户信息

一旦我们拿到了Access Token,就可以使用它向苹果服务器请求用户信息了。用户信息包括用户ID、邮箱地址等信息,可以根据需要存储到自己的数据库中,以便后续使用。

4、总结

通过以上步骤,我们可以在安卓系统中实现苹果id登录功能。总的来说,要实现苹果id登录,我们需要自己的服务器来实现Apple ID的登录认证。也就是说,用户需要先在应用中输入Apple ID和密码,然后通过客户端与自己的服务器进行交互,最终实现Apple ID登录。

扫描二维码推送至手机访问。

版权声明:本文由Apple ID来好成知识!发布,如需转载请注明出处。

转载请注明出处https://lhczs.cn/shouji/34758.html

分享给朋友:

相关文章

苹果六无法更换id(苹果六更换电池)

苹果六无法更换id(苹果六更换电池)

苹果六无法更换id的问题一直困扰着不少苹果用户。无法更换id的原因主要是苹果公司为保护用户的隐私和账号安全,采用了严格的安全验证机制。然而,对于用户来说,这意味着如果忘记了原始id,或者账号被盗用,就...

大冶有解苹果ID吗

大冶有解苹果ID吗

大冶是中国湖北省的一个县级市,位于江汉平原的中部。近年来,苹果产品在全球范围内受到了广泛的欢迎和使用。很多人在购买苹果产品后需要注册一个苹果ID,用于管理和享受产品相关的服务。那么,大冶这个城市是否有...

苹果id怎么强揭开(苹果id号怎么申请)

苹果id怎么强揭开(苹果id号怎么申请)

如何强揭开苹果ID的密码保护?苹果ID是苹果公司为了登录使用和存储用户的信息而创建的账户。本篇文章将会探讨如何忘记苹果ID密码时如何重置并更改它,以及如何防止苹果ID信息遭到滥用。 1、密码重置...

苹果没id找回照片(苹果手机id退了照片怎么找回)

苹果没id找回照片(苹果手机id退了照片怎么找回)

苹果没id找回照片 1、没有备份的照片丢失带来的难过 随着科技的发展,我们拍摄照片的机会越来越多,照片也逐渐成为我们珍藏生活回忆的方式。如果在某个时刻,我们不小心把手机重置了,或者手机出现故障,导...

在哪里修改苹果id(在哪里修改苹果蓝牙名字)

在哪里修改苹果id(在哪里修改苹果蓝牙名字)

在哪里修改苹果id? 1、在iPhone/iPad上修改 苹果id是我们在购买、使用苹果设备、iTunes商店等场合中最常用的一个账号,有时候我们需要修改其中的一些信息。对于iPhone或者iPa...

苹果id商店使用检查(苹果id商店检查美国版)

苹果id商店使用检查(苹果id商店检查美国版)

苹果ID商店使用检查 1、账号安全 苹果ID登录商店需要输入密码,为了保证账号安全,建议设置较为复杂的密码,包括数字、字母和特殊字符,同时还需定期更改密码。 另外,也可以在设置中开启两步验证功能...